The overview below groups typical Bricklaying proj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Charlotte,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or brick repairs or patching in Charlotte range from $250 to $600, covering simple fixes like replacing a few bricks or sealing cracks.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age.
Standard Masonry Projects - Larger projects such as building a small brick wall or chimney can cost between $1,500 and $3,500. These are common for residential properties and often involve moderate complexity and material costs.
Full Brick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of a brick facade or structure can range from $4,000 to $8,000, with larger, more intricate projects reaching $10,000+ depending on size and design details.
Complex or Custom Work - Highly detailed or custom brickwork, such as ornate facades or large retaining walls, can exceed $15,000. These projects are less frequent and typically involve specialized craftsmanship and mater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ating potential service providers. Homeowners should seek out contractors who can provide detailed project descriptions, including the scope of work, materials to be used, and any specific design considerations. Having these details in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is on the same page from the start. It’s also wise to discuss how changes or unforeseen issues will be handled, which can contribute to a smoother project experience and better outcomes.
